It is not advisable to hold your pee all night. Holding urine for extended periods can lead to urinary tract infections, bladder dysfunction, and kidney issues. Aim to use the restroom before bed and if you need to go during the night, it’s best to get up and relieve yourself.

  1. What happens if you hold your pee for too long? Holding urine for extended periods can increase the risk of urinary tract infections, bladder dysfunction, and kidney problems.
  2. Is it safe to hold urine overnight? It is not recommended to hold urine all night. It’s better to use the restroom before bed and when necessary during the night to avoid health issues.
  3. Can holding pee cause kidney damage? Yes, consistently holding urine for long periods may lead to pressure build-up in the urinary tract, which can negatively affect kidney health.
